When you've been somewhere to eat and had a really good time, it's always a little bit daunting to know whether to recommend it to your family and friends. Maybe you hit it on a good day, and the next time will be disappointing.
With the Cavendish, there's no need to worry. We had eaten there one evening in 2007 and had a very good meal; so when we had a family weekend in Buxton this summer, we had good idea what to expect. As some members were travelling cross country, we phoned ahead to reserve a table for 8.30pm. As it turns out, we were the last group to arrive; so clearly the staff had stayed back to serve us. We have some fairly 'experienced' diners in our group and they were impressed by the interesting looking menu - and we were all impressed by the execution of what appeared on the plates. All beautifully cooked and with a true gourmet's delight of flavours and textures.
The staff were excellent throughout - never less than attentive even as the evening drew on. Perfect.

We ate here on Friday night after arriving in Buxton looking for somewhere to eat. We werenʼs sure whether it was a cafe or a restaurant but decided to give it a whirl. We were so glad we did. The food was exquisite, spiced pear with goats cheese for starters was out of this world, followed by Baked Mushrooms with Roast Veg. Both were faultless, and with the friendly attitude of the staff we will definitely be going back.

Very friendly place to eat. Excellent value. Food is of good quality and prepared with care. House wine is decent and comes in a choice of two sizes of glass. Interesting place to sit and look around at the the unusual decor - fascinating designs in the barrel-vaulted glass roof. Looking forward to my next visit.
